Octave Ventures is a venture capital investment firm founded in 2018, with operations based in Toronto, Canada, and Henderson, Nevada. The firm specializes in investing in seed-stage, early-stage, and later-stage companies, primarily focusing on deep technology and biotechnology sectors. With a global perspective, Octave Ventures aims to support innovative enterprises that are poised to advance these cutting-edge fields.

ZeroEyes
Venture Round in 2023
ZeroEyes, Inc. is an artificial intelligence-based security company focused on firearm detection and prevention of active shooter incidents. Founded in 2018 and based in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, the company analyzes over three billion images daily from security camera feeds to identify weapons and provide immediate alerts to authorities. Its platform enhances safety in various environments, including schools, workplaces, healthcare facilities, and public events, by improving situational awareness and reducing response times for first responders. ZeroEyes aims to combat mass shootings and gun-related violence by integrating advanced technology into security systems, thereby addressing critical safety concerns in education, commercial travel, and government sectors.

General Radar
Series A in 2022
General Radar, founded in 2016 and headquartered in Mountain View, California, specializes in the development of high-resolution phased array millimeter-wave radar technology tailored for autonomous systems, particularly in the autonomous vehicles industry. The company focuses on creating advanced radar services that are commercially scalable, reliable, and affordable. Its multi-mission Active Electronically Scanned Array (AESA) radars utilize digital beamforming and supercomputing capabilities, allowing for innovative applications across both commercial and defense sectors.
FreeWire
Series D in 2022
FreeWire Technologies, Inc. specializes in mobile electric vehicle (EV) chargers and battery-integrated charging solutions. Founded in 2014 and based in San Leandro, California, the company produces various models, including the Mobi Charger series, which caters to different charging needs with options for manual operation and semi-autonomous functionality. FreeWire's flagship product, the Boost Charger, connects to existing low-voltage utility services and provides high-power charging without requiring significant grid upgrades. This innovative technology allows for ultrafast EV charging, making it suitable for diverse applications, including commercial customers, fleets, and retail locations. FreeWire has established partnerships with major companies and is actively deploying its solutions across the U.S. and internationally, including a collaboration with bp pulse in the UK. By offering clean and efficient power alternatives, FreeWire aims to support the transition away from fossil fuels and enhance the EV charging infrastructure.
Cornami
Series C in 2022
Cornami, Inc. is a high-performance computing company based in Campbell, California, with additional offices in Sacramento and Boston. Founded in 2011, Cornami has developed a patented multi-core technology that enhances software performance, power efficiency, and latency while significantly increasing compute performance. This innovative approach allows processor cores to function as scalable resources, similar to memory and storage, facilitating real-time computing with minimal cost and power consumption. Cornami's technology aims to support a variety of markets, with an initial emphasis on Big Data, by enabling real-time fully homomorphic encryption and providing high-performance computing capabilities across diverse devices and platforms.

RED 6
Venture Round in 2021
RED 6 Inc. is a company specializing in outdoor augmented reality solutions aimed at enhancing air combat training.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Santa Monica, California, it has developed the Airborne Tactical Augmented Reality System (ATARS). This innovative system allows real pilots in actual aircraft to engage with synthetically generated enemy threats in real time, utilizing augmented reality visors and an AI-driven multiplayer network. The technology also incorporates biometric feedback loops to optimize training experiences. RED 6's solutions are designed to revolutionize military training applications, enabling enhanced readiness and operational effectiveness for armed forces worldwide. In addition to military applications, the technology holds potential for various industries, including entertainment, sports, and medicine.

Finch Therapeutics
Series D in 2020
Finch Therapeutics is a microbiome technology company focused on developing microbial therapies for patients with serious medical needs. The company utilizes donor-derived Full-Spectrum Microbiota and Rationally-Selected Microbiota platforms to create complete microbiome communities aimed at restoring functionality and addressing conditions caused by microbiome disruption. Finch offers oral microbiome treatments targeting recurrent C. difficile infections, chronic hepatitis B, inflammatory bowel disease, and gastrointestinal symptoms in children with autism. By employing machine learning algorithms, Finch analyzes clinical data to identify effective microbial combinations, thereby minimizing translational risks associated with drug development.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Somerville, Massachusetts, Finch Therapeutics holds a significant portfolio of intellectual property, including over 70 patents related to microbiome therapeutics.
Luminar
Venture Round in 2019
Luminar Technologies, Inc. is a vehicle sensor and software company based in Orlando, Florida, specializing in safety and autonomous technology for passenger vehicles and trucks. Founded in 2012, the company operates through two primary segments. The Autonomy Solutions segment focuses on designing, manufacturing, and selling lidar sensors along with related perception and autonomy software for original equipment manufacturers in various sectors, including automotive, commercial vehicles, and robo-taxis. Meanwhile, the Other Component Sales segment provides design, testing, and consulting services for non-standard integrated circuits, primarily serving government agencies and defense contractors. Luminar's advanced driver assistance systems enhance safety by offering detection capabilities for both low and high-speed driving scenarios.

Palantir Technologies
Venture Round in 2018
Palantir Technologies develops data fusion platforms tailored for public institutions, commercial enterprises, and non-profit organizations globally. Its primary offerings include Palantir Gotham, which integrates, manages, secures, and analyzes enterprise data, and Palantir Foundry, designed for commercial applications that enhance collaboration and data analysis. The company's software aids various sectors, including government, defense, finance, and healthcare, in navigating large and complex data sets to improve operational efficiency and decision-making. Palantir's solutions address a range of critical areas such as anti-fraud, crisis response, cyber security, and healthcare delivery. Founded in 2003 and headquartered in Palo Alto, California, the company maintains strategic partnerships to enhance its service offerings.
